Yee) Newsgroups: comp.windows.x Subject: Re: mwm question Message-ID: Date: 2 Aug 90 17:15:16 GMT References: Sender: news@OSF.ORG Organization: Open Software Foundation Lines: 21 In-reply-to: tim@cs.columbia.edu's message of 31 Jul 90 13:22:16 GMT In article tim@cs.columbia.edu (Timothy Jones) writes: > How can I tell mwm not to place an icon in the icon box for a particular > application, like xclock? > > Thanks, > Tim > You can't. Mwm creates an icon for all regular clients. BUT, if you really really really really really really want this behavior, you can modify the xclock source to create the window with the override_redirect attribute set to true. Mwm will not decorate or make icons for override_redirect windows. =Mike -- = Michael K.
